1113.09 PARKING; OPEN STORAGE OF SUPPLIES, MATERIAL AND    EQUIPMENT; AND ACCUMULATION OF WASTE PROHIBITED.
   (a)    No person, being the owner, occupant or any person having the care of any building or lot of land within the City shall allow a boat, tractor, truck, trailer, recreation vehicle or other equipment and supplies to be parked and/or stored on any residential lot unless they are parked and/or stored in an enclosed structure; however, boats, trailers, and recreational vehicles twenty-four (24) feet or less in length may be parked and/or stored in accordance with Section 1121.05 Parking and Storage of Vehicles in Residential Districts.
   (b)    No person, being the owner, occupant or any person havlng the care of any building or lot of land within the City shall allow for the open storage of materials and equipment such as building and construction materials, or lawn equipment.
   (c)    No person, being the owner, occupant, or any person having the care of any building or lot of land within the City shall cause or allow trash, junk, or any scrap materials such as automobile, trailer or vehicle chassis, parts, tires or sections, household appliances, lumber, scrap iron, old metal, rope, plastic, bottles, pipe, conduit paper/paperboard, Styrofoam, rags, stoves, furniture or other waste materials to remain or accumulate on, in or about such building or lot. (Ord. 2022-76. Passed 1-31-23.)
